中国DOS联盟

-- 联合DOS 推动DOS 发展DOS --

联盟域名:www.cn-dos.net 论坛域名:www.cn-dos.net/forum
DOS,代表着自由开放与发展,我们努力起来,学习FreeDOS和Linux的自由开放与GNU精神,共同创造和发展美好的自由与GNU GPL世界吧!

中国DOS联盟论坛
现在时间是 2026-06-28 08:47
中国DOS联盟论坛 » DOS疑难解答 & 问题讨论 (解答室) » 请问在Dos状态下怎样正确读取或拷贝光盘中长文件名文件? 查看 1,078 回复 1
楼 主 请问在Dos状态下怎样正确读取或拷贝光盘中长文件名文件? 发表于 2004-10-13 00:00 ·  中国 广东 佛山 联通
初级用户
积分 105
发帖 1
注册 2004-10-13 00:00
21年会员
UID 32464
性别 男
状态 离线
在用启动盘启动DOS的状况下,我用DOSLFN使得DOS支持长文件名,然后查看每个硬盘分区,都能正确的显示长文件名文件,复制时候,长文件名文件也顺利复制,没有变成8.3模式,软盘也一样,但是在查看光盘时,长文件名文件就会变成8.3模式,复制到硬盘也是一样,所以想把光盘的内容复制到硬盘时有一些长文件名的文件名就会给改名为8.3模式,使得这些数据在使用时出错,还有一种情况,就是如果光盘是刻录盘,查看时就会是不知道是什么的字符,在windows就不会这样,请问为什么会这样,有什么方法解决查看和复制长文件名文件时候,文件名能被正确的查看和复制。
2 发表于 2004-10-14 00:00 ·  中国 河北 石家庄 联通
铂金会员
★★★★
网络独行侠
积分 6,962
发帖 2,753
注册 2003-04-16 00:00
23年会员
UID 1565
性别 男
来自 河北保定
状态 离线
DOS的光驱驱动大部分都只是支持ISO9660这种标准的光盘文件系统,而不支持Joilet、RockRidge等文件系统,所以也就只能支持8.3格式的文件名,这是驱动程序的原因,跟doslfn没有关系,估计解决办法就是换一个DOS下能够支持各种光盘文件系统的光驱驱动程序,暂时我还不知道有没有这样的驱动程序。
偶只喜欢回答那些标题和描述都很清晰的帖子!
如想解决问题,请认真学习“这个帖子”和“这个帖子”并努力遵守,如果可能,请告诉更多的人!
论坛跳转: